Output 23d7568df60fce77981f644a1acef78fcecdc403af085ae5d8c7de0d3126cc04:0

value
4048114917
script pubkey
OP_0 OP_PUSHBYTES_20 48c7c92baefb5fda67dc8bc0ad1327c62a9db143
address
ltc1qfrruj2awld0a5e7u30q26ye8cc4fmv2rt6efw8
transaction
23d7568df60fce77981f644a1acef78fcecdc403af085ae5d8c7de0d3126cc04
spent
true